Day 7 part 6 – The One With The Criss-Crossing
In the week after I gave birth I lost about half the weight I had gained during pregnancy. Then over the following 6 months not only did I not lose any more weight, I gained back a few pounds. After this Disney trip I weighed myself and realized that I was finally back at my healthy weight (or very close to). I blame being sick and barely eating for a week, and all the walking we did at Disney. We seriously criss-cross the parks SO MUCH. That morning we had already done all of Fantasyland (including Storybook Circus and FLE), Liberty Square, Tomorrowland, and we were now going to Frontierland. And in this update alone we will also go BACK to Tomorrowland before visiting Adventureland. I’m exhausted just writing about it, but when we are there we don’t even realize it. We just want to see as much as possible! So as I was saying, we were walking to Frontierland so we could use our Big Thunder Mountain FPs. Ron had to stop along the way to make a bottle and feed Claudia. I was pretty sure they wouldn’t give us a baby swap without seeing the baby, but they had done so at Space Mountain earlier that day so Ron insisted we try. Otaku and I left them near the Shooting Arcade and walked up to BTM’s entrance. ![]() Sure enough, the older CM at the FP entrance refused to give us a baby swap, even though we were only 2 but had three fastpasses. We walked back to the shooting arcade to find Ron. ![]() We got him and walked back to the ride, but slower this time so I took pictures. ![]() ![]() By the time we made it back to BTM it was a new CM at the entrance and he didn’t seem to care as much. He barely looked at the stroller before giving us a baby swap. Really we could have pointed to any random stroller and it would have been fine. I snapped a few pictures as we made our way through the queue. ![]() ![]() Less than 5 minutes later we boarded the mine train. ![]() I kept the camera out to document our journey on the wildest ride in the wilderness. ![]() ![]() ![]() By the time we got off we were getting hungry. Since baby swap passes don’t have a time limit on them (only a date), we decided to go have lunch. We were right by Pecos Bill and had plans on going to Adventureland next, it would make sense to eat there, right? ![]() Wrong! Ron was in the mood for Cosmic Rays so we walked allllllllll the way back to Tomorrowland. We found an empty table outside. Ron stayed there with Claudia while we went inside. Both Otaku and Ron wanted chicken, so she ordered for the two of them while I went and got my own lunch (you order and get your food at three different “bays” depending on what you want). I had a cheeseburger, and made it to my liking at the fixings bar (very similar to Pecos Bill). ![]() Otaku got chicken nuggets. ![]() Ron had his eyes set on the half chicken with mashed potatoes. He thought for a quick-service that it was pretty good. He said the mashed potatoes were tasty and so was the chicken. ![]() Can you believe we had already done 7 rides, met one character and had lunch and it wasn’t even 1pm yet? I remember texting Hope and telling her how it was a much better day than our last MK day and we were having a great time. What a difference a few days make! To keep with the theme of criss-crossing the park, we went to Adventureland next. Walking through the hub means taking yet another castle picture, right? I mean, isn’t there a rule where you can’t walk in front of the castle without photographing it? Plus, Dream Along With Mickey was going on. ![]() Here’s a proof of where we were heading. ![]() It was our first time in this area for this trip (except for stopping to get Jungle Cruise FPs at some point that day. Maybe on our way to lunch???). It’s such a beautiful area! ![]() It was so empty! ![]() ![]() As I mentioned we had Jungle Cruise FPs to use. It was about 1:20pm and there were FPs available for 40 minutes later! ![]() I took too many pictures though, so this will have to wait for the next update. |

Skydiving Hi guys! I'm super busy this month and the next, between attending 4 birthday parties, planning Peanut's first birthday, and a few other things. Not too mention, report cards time is fast approaching at school. Thankfully, tomorrow is a holiday in Canada so I finally have the skydiving update. We had a GORGEOUS day. Sunny, barely any clouds in the sky, no wind, and very warm. It could not have been any more perfect. We were very lucky because the weather is often not so nice/warm in early May. We got there around 2pm, paid, signed the waivers putting our life in their hands, watched a little video, then got dressed. We didn't have to wait long at all before it was time to get in the plane. ![]() Here's a pic of me with my instructor. ![]() I paid for the video, which means another guy was diving with us, with a camera strapped to his head. All the following pictures are basically taken straight from the video. He went out first and held onto the side of the plane, so he could film me jumping. Basically I was on my knee and it was the instructor that would control when we would fall. It only took a few seconds, really not enough time to be scared. ![]() ![]() ![]() He lets go almost at the same time as us. here we go! ![]() ![]() ![]() Free falling really feels just like floating. You do not get the "stomach in your throat" feeling like in TOT. I think it's because the plane already goes fast, so you don't really "accelerate". ![]() ![]() Blowing a kiss to the people at home. ![]() We moved a bit away so we could turn and see everything. ![]() When we came back closer, the guy filming me reached out to take my hand. ![]() ![]() He made me turn some more, then he let go. ![]() My instructor motions to him that it's almost time to separate. ![]() Some final pictures. ![]() Then it's time to say goodbye. The guy filming continues to free fall so he can be ahead of us. ![]() The parachute opens. The free fall lasted about 50 seconds. The best 50 seconds of the jump!!! ![]() ![]() ![]() The following 5 minutes were not filmed. I thought the part with the parachute open would be smooth and slow, but it wasn't. I could feel us moving a lot more than during the "fall", and there was a lot of twirling and fast turns. I suffer from motion sickness, and it made me VERY nauseous. To the point that I gagged several times. My instructor even got worried, but I was able to hold it in and make it safely to he ground. You can see me coming here. ![]() ![]() ![]() Right after landing the video guy asked me about my jump. My first words were: I fell nauseous, and I don't think I will do it again". Don't get me wrong, I was very PROUD to have done it, and have no regret. One thing to check off the bucket list. I just did not appreciate the ending. The next day, though... I was already saying that with a good anti-nausea medecine and a warning to the instructor not to twirl too much, I would go again. |
